
Aboriginal Literature
Aboriginal literature encompasses the stories, poems, and writings of Indigenous peoples of Australia, reflecting their histories, cultures, beliefs, and connection to the land. It serves as a vital means of preserving tradition, sharing personal and collective experiences, and expressing identity. These works often incorporate oral storytelling, Dreamtime stories, and contemporary voices, providing insight into Indigenous worldviews and struggles. Aboriginal literature is essential for understanding Australia's cultural diversity, fostering respect, and highlighting issues of cultural preservation and reconciliation.
